2. Fundamental Concepts of Multipliers

a. The mathematical foundation: How multipliers amplify outcomes

Mathematically, a multiplier is a coefficient that increases the base value of an outcome. For example, if a user wins 10 points with a 3x multiplier, their total reward becomes 30 points. This simple concept underpins many digital features, where the use of multipliers results in exponential growth of results, thereby making experiences more compelling and rewarding.

b. Types of multipliers in digital contexts: revenue, engagement, and retention

  • Revenue multipliers: Features like bonus bets or double payouts that increase monetary gains.
  • Engagement multipliers: Rewards such as extra spins or XP boosts that encourage more interaction.
  • Retention multipliers: Loyalty points or streak bonuses that incentivize long-term participation.

7. Non-Obvious Depths: Psychological and Behavioral Insights

a. How multipliers influence player psychology and decision-making

Multipliers tap into fundamental psychological drivers like the desire for reward and the thrill of chance. They can create a positive feedback loop, where anticipation of larger rewards encourages risk-taking, which in turn enhances satisfaction when achieved. Understanding these effects helps designers craft features that motivate without exploiting.

b. The concept of positive feedback loops and their role in user retention

When users experience increasingly rewarding outcomes due to multipliers, they develop a habit of returning. This phenomenon, a positive feedback loop, sustains engagement by reinforcing behavior through perceived success and excitement. Properly managed, these loops foster loyalty and long-term participation.

c. Ethical considerations: avoiding manipulative practices while maximizing value

While multipliers can enhance experiences, ethical design is paramount. Features should be transparent and avoid encouraging compulsive behavior. Responsible use involves clear communication about odds and rewards, ensuring that players understand the odds and are empowered to make informed decisions.
